With Casper City Council planning to revisit its five-month-old public indoor smoking ban, Smokefree Natrona County says, in the coming weeks, it will watch the actions of council closely.

Smokefree Natrona County says it will do whatever it takes to keep the ban in place.

“We have worked far too hard to go down without a serious fight,” Smokefree Natrona County spokesperson Kenny Ainsworth said in a press release last week. “Everyone in Casper deserves the right to breathe clean air – we are prepared to make sure that we continue to be protected from secondhand smoke long into the future.”

Smokefree Natrona County representative Anna Edwards says her organization will do its best to keep council members informed about the consequences of repealing the ban.

“We are willing to do what it takes to educate the four new council members,” Edwards said. “We’re going to be there at the meetings to show support of this ordiance.”
